Custom Compass Rose/mat


Here are a few photos of a little side project I have been working on. it's a 20Sq/Ft Mat with a compass rose in the middle of it. Everything you see came from scrap/extra 12x12" tiles. In the next few weeks I'm going to do another mat in a room right next to this one that is going to make this one look elementary.

Thom, none of the colors are flipped. Nothing that obvious. This all started from one I did in marble years ago, too. I did a bathroom for a guy who loved to sail, and wanted one with a long point showing true north. It actually ended up being a few degrees to east, but it was close enough!! Since that time, I've done probably 10-12 of different sizes, from 15" on a backsplash to 11' in a showroom floor. Adam's helped me on several of those, but this is the first one he's done, and it was all on his own. I offered to help him, and he declined. (probably why it turned out so well!! )
